WSC urges US to lead way over piracy legislation

by Obsidian last modified Feb 09, 2009 12:00 AM

by Lloyd's List in London 10:49AM, 09 Feb 2009

The World Shipping Council (WSC) has called on the US Government to form a legal agreement with other nations to imprison pirates, after an upsurge in piracy attacks in the Gulf of Aden, Lloyds List reported today.
